1) Mix Some Oats, Sleep, Eat!

Let’s talk about the easiest breakfast ever, friends! Overnight oats are literally a game-changer for busy mornings when we’re trying to wrangle kids and get everyone out the door on time.

The basic recipe couldn’t be simpler. All you need is oats and milk! That’s it! A 1:1 ratio works perfectly – like one cup of oats to one cup of milk. We love how customizable this breakfast superhero is.

Just mix those two ingredients in a jar or container before bed, and voilà! While you’re catching those precious zzz’s (which we know are rare as parents), the oats are soaking up all that liquid and getting soft and delicious.

No cooking required! Can we get a hallelujah? The oats absorb the milk overnight and become perfectly soft and ready to eat by morning. It’s basically breakfast magic happening while you sleep!

We’ve found that adding some yogurt takes these oats to the next level. Try using half as much yogurt as your oats and milk half as much yogurt, for extra creaminess. It adds a nice protein boost too!

The best part? You can make a bunch of jars at once and they’ll stay good in the fridge for up to a week. Talk about meal prep winning! That’s multiple mornings of grab-and-go breakfast sorted.

2) Fruit Frenzy Overnight Delight

A colorful array of various fruits, such as strawberries, blueberries, and bananas, scattered around six jars of overnight oats

Let’s talk about our favorite way to jazz up overnight oats – with a rainbow of fresh fruits! This Fruit Frenzy version is a total game-changer for breakfast, and we’re obsessed with how pretty it looks in the jar.

Start with your basic overnight oats recipe – we like using 1/4 cup of milk, 1/3 cup of yogurt, 1/4 cup of oats, and some chia seeds. Mix them together and you’ve got your canvas ready for fruity masterpieces!

Now for the fun part – fruit layering! We love creating colorful layers with berries, sliced bananas, diced apples, or whatever fruits are hanging out in our fridge. The natural sweetness means you can totally skip the added sugar if you’re trying to be healthy (but no judgment if you add a drizzle of honey!).

Fresh fruit works overnight oatmeal amazingly, but don’t sleep on frozen options! They actually release juices overnight that infuse cold milk and your oats with incredible flavor. Plus, they’re usually cheaper and last longer – perfect for our chaotic mom life where grocery shopping happens… eventually.

Pro tip from our kitchen disasters: if you’re using fruits that brown easily (looking at you, bananas and apples), either add them right before eating or toss them with a little lemon juice first. Nothing sadder than brown fruit ruining your breakfast aesthetic!

3) Almond Butter Dream Cream

A jar of almond butter sits on a kitchen counter surrounded by oats, a measuring cup, and a spoon. The ingredients are ready to be mixed together to make overnight oats

Let’s talk about one of our favorite overnight oats recipes – the dreamy, creamy almond butter version! This breakfast option is a total game-changer for busy mornings when we’re rushing to get the kids out the door.

The magic of these Almond Butter Overnight Oats is in their simplicity. We combine rolled oats with creamy almond butter, and the result is nothing short of amazing. The almond butter adds this rich, nutty flavor that makes regular oats feel fancy!

We love adding a splash of almond milk to keep things dairy-free, but regular milk works great too. A drizzle of maple syrup gives just enough sweetness without going overboard. Because let’s be honest, nobody needs a sugar crash at 10 AM!

For extra nutrition, we always toss in some chia seeds which plump up overnight and add a fun texture. Plus, they’re packed with omega-3s and fiber – sneaky nutrition for the win!

The prep is ridiculously easy. Just throw everything in a mason jar, give it a good shake, and pop it in the fridge. That’s it! Even with toddlers hanging on our legs, we can manage this recipe.

6) Tropical Coconut Escape

Who doesn’t dream of a beach vacation while eating breakfast? We’re bringing those island vibes straight to your morning routine with this heavenly tropical creation!

This dreamy recipe overnight oats will have you feeling like you’re sipping piña coladas by the ocean. Tropical coconut overnight oats mix up in minutes but taste like you spent hours making them. Magic!

Ready for the basics? Start with your trusty rolled oats and add creamy coconut milk instead of regular milk. This simple swap transforms ordinary oats into something special. The coconut flavor is subtle but unmistakable.

Now for the fun part – mix in some chunks of juicy pineapple! We love using fresh when it’s available, but canned works perfectly too (just drain the juice first). The sweet-tart flavor pairs amazingly with the coconut.

For extra tropical flair, we recommend a sprinkle of toasted coconut flakes on top. They add the perfect crunch and amp up that vacation vibe. You deserve this little morning luxury!

Some recipes call for a touch of maple syrup or honey, for sweetness, but taste your mixture first. If your pineapple is super sweet, you might not need it!

We’ve been known to throw in some chia and pumpkin seeds too.

How To Experiment With Flavors

Let’s get wild with our best overnight oats recipe! Start with a solid base recipe of oats, milk, sweetener, and chia seeds, then let your imagination run free.

We love playing with different flavor combinations by adding:

  • Extracts & Spices: A few drops of vanilla, almond, or coconut extract can transform your oats!

  • Don’t forget cinnamon, cardamom, or nutmeg for warmth.

  • Sweet Mix-ins: Try cocoa powder, peanut butter, or maple syrup for a dessert-like breakfast that’s actually healthy!

  • Toppings Bar: Create a toppings station with nuts, seeds, and dried fruits for the family to customize their jars.

Don’t be afraid to try unexpected combinations like chocolate-cherry or even pumpkin pie spice!

Incorporating Seasonal Ingredients

We’re all about making the most of what’s fresh and in-season!

Rotating your overnight oats ingredients with the seasons keeps breakfast exciting. It also makes it budget-friendly too.

Spring/Summer Stars:

  • Fresh berries (strawberries, blueberries, raspberries)

  • Juicy peaches and nectarines

  • Tropical fruits like mango and pineapple

  • Fresh herbs like mint or basil (trust us, it works!)

Fall/Winter Favorites:

  • Diced apples with cinnamon (hello, apple pie vibes!)

  • Pumpkin puree with pumpkin spice

  • Cranberries with orange zest

  • Roasted sweet potato (sounds crazy, tastes amazing!)
